Faf du Plessis loves going shirtless but it isn't sure he is a Salman Khan fan or not. The South African cricketer has been caught shirtless many times. Even during the fight between Quinton de Kock and David Warner, Du Plessis was seen in a towel and that was all over the internet as a meme.

Faf was seen once again shirtless during Chennai Super Kings (CSK)'s game against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) at Wankhede Stadium. The humidity in Mumbai was taking a toll at Du Plessis and he decided to change his shirt. 

Graeme Smith, who pulled his leg in the post-match presentation for going shirtless, posted a story on Instagram and asked Faf to explain it.

Du Plessis turned out to be the match winner for CSK as his unbeaten 67 off 42 balls took his team to seventh Indian Premier League (IPL) final. They were struggling at one stage, but the South African didn't let SRH run away with the game and stunned them with a magnificent knock.
